We’re on a mission to protect society from fraud and money laundering. We’ve already protected over 3 million people through life’s big transactions. Fraud and regulation are rising, costing the UK economy over £100bn every year; this makes it more difficult for businesses to protect themselves and their clients from fraud and money laundering. Our co-founders were led to this area when a friend was defrauded of £25K when buying their first property. At the time, anti‑fraud technology didn’t exist, which meant that completing the anti‑fraud checks required in these processes was largely manual. These big life moments should be exciting, but instead are often confusing and scary due to the painful process of completing these paper‑based checks and the risk of fraud. Thirdfort helps businesses to facilitate these anti‑fraud checks so that individuals know they can transact safely and seamlessly with professionals during these big transactions. Our anti‑fraud platform provides a secure way for professionals in regulated sectors like Lawyers, Estate Agents and Accountants to transfer funds and verify sensitive information through app‑based document checks, facial recognition and open banking. Over 1,500 businesses now trust Thirdfort to verify their clients. We are FCA regulated and have raised over $33m in capital from leading Fintech investors.
About the role: TechOps at Thirdfort enables teams to do their best work by building reliable, secure internal systems and processes, and increasingly, by using AI and automation to remove manual effort at scale.
What you’ll be doing:
- Redesign workflows for an AI‑first world; embedding LLMs, automations, and better tooling where they create real value.
- Build things yourself: prototype in n8n, write a Python script, call an API, wire up a Notion AI agent.
- Identify and implement automation opportunities that reduce manual work across teams.
- Embed deeply across the business, partnering hands‑on with different teams day to day.
- Handle some core TechOps work too: basic IT support, device management, SaaS admin.
- Own and continuously improve our internal tooling and operational workflows (e.g. Google Workspace, Notion, Slack, MDM, password management, etc.).
- Improve how access is requested, granted, documented, and reviewed—balancing security and practicality.
- Support secure onboarding and device setup practices across the company.
- Coordinate joiner onboarding steps with People and managers: account provisioning, group membership, security setup, and first‑day readiness.
- Manage hardware procurement and laptop setup, including MDM enrolment and baseline security configuration.
What success looks like:
- Teams have adopted practical AI solutions that run reliably day‑to‑day.
- Reduced manual work through automation and better workflows.
- Clearer access management and better visibility over who has access to what.
- Security posture improves through practical controls and high completion of required training.
- New joiners are onboarded smoothly, securely, and on time.
